Police are appealing for information about a road traffic collision near Cradley on Friday.
West Mercia police were called shortly after 6.30pm on Friday 16 November 2018 to an RTC near Cradley, Herefordshire between a silver BMW 5 series estate and a blue Nissan Micra.
The vehicles were travelling west on the A4103 Herefordshire when the collision occurred. One of the vehicles landed in a ditch.
Highways and paramedics attended and two occupants of the Micra were conveyed to hospital by ambulance, one of them with serious arm injuries.
Road closures were put in place while the RTC was dealt with. Anyone with information is asked to contact police on 101 quoting incident 701S of 16 November 2018.
